  • Chuck Berry     (Singer, songwriter, guitarist, Rock & Roll Hall of Fame inductee)
    • Born: Charles Edward Anderson Berry
    • He was born in Saint Louis (MO) on October 18, 1926 (a Monday) and died in Wentzville (MO) on March 18, 2017 (a Saturday) at the age of 90.
    • Wentzville is located 16 miles [25.7 km] to the north of Augusta.

  • Gerty Theresa Radnitz Cori     (Biochemist and Nobel prize recipient)
    • She was born in Prague (Czech Republic) on August 15, 1896 (a Saturday) and died in Glendale (MO) on October 26, 1957 (a Saturday) at the age of 61. She is buried at Bellefontaine Cemetery (Saint Louis City, Missouri).
    • Glendale is located 27 miles [43.5 km] to the east of Augusta.

  • Cal Neeman     (Major League Baseball)
    • Full name: Calvin Amends Neeman
    • He was born in Valmeyer (IL) on February 18, 1929 (a Monday) and died in Lake Saint Louis (MO) on October 1, 2015 (a Thursday) at the age of 86.
    • Lake Saint Louis is located 15 miles [24.1 km] to the north of Augusta.
